frustrated mother of toddler

I have done everything like they doctors, specialist, etc. and it still seems like he needs to use pred. med. he is 2 1/2 and regularly used pulmicort, zyrtex, singulair, and when bad xopenex., then after another day or two we always seem to have to go to pred. med. It seems like it is the only thing, that will allow him and us to sleep, My heart hurts when I hear him coughing all night. he was tested for allergies and everything came back negative.
I still did get rid of the dog, to see if any improvements, as of yet, nothing. in fact tonight we had to give him pred. it seems like once a month for four days he needs it.... Any suggestions, I am willing to look at any ideas.

Re: frustrated mother of toddler

My 4 year old is on all of the same meds save for the oral steroid. We wont do the oral prednisone anymore. Steroids are hard on your immune system. When the immune system is down, you catch everything there is to catch. Too many steroids can actually make your child sicker. Oral steroids have also been linked to growth retardation in children so our Allergist recommended we go off of them for good.

So your child is getting a double dose of steroids with the Pulmocort and the Orapred. When we did that system, we found out that we were only maintaning. That is no way to live.

Now we have a plan, I would really recommend getting an Asthma plan through your Dr, and it has helped so much. We do Singulair and Zyrtec every night regardless of symptoms. We do Pulmicort twice a day regardless of symptoms. If there are symptoms, which a runny nose is a symptom in this house, we start the Xopenex. We do Xopenex every 4 hours as needed. If the Xopenex does not last the full 4 hours, we go to every 2 hours. If we have to do it beyond every 2 hours, she goes to the ER. We also look for signs like retractions and respiration count.

My daughter tested negative for all allergies but gets sick with any weather change. I am keeping an open mind to getting her tested again as young children are notorious for testing negative for allergies they actually have. We also have pillow and mattress protectors as I think a huge problem with my daughter is dust mites. I dont use feather dusters for the house, wash the curtains often and the sheets and bedding twice a week. We are also considering wood flooring. I also dont allow stuffed animals in bed.

I would seriously talk to the Dr about finding out your sons zones and stopping that oral steroid. HTH and Good luck
